Output 084c486984c8e6eda1e5b2afc1086be184b68b8a7f9d02684cddd92dc98424ed:3

value
2490804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50252e9a7aa281aa8f6ef773c2c0af03f3b651c OP_EQUAL
address
3M7JdsPE9CpgkAbUhvmHnouBuHgJiym5SC
transaction
084c486984c8e6eda1e5b2afc1086be184b68b8a7f9d02684cddd92dc98424ed
spent
true